Xiaomi is soon going to launch a new smartphone under its Redmi 9 series. Called Redmi 9i, the phone is slated to go official on September 15. Ahead of the official launch, Redmi 9i is already listed on Flipkart and mi.com. The listings reveal a few important features of the upcoming phone.
According to the listing, Redmi 9i will come with 4GB of RAM. The phone is also confirmed to come with MIUI 12 out-of-the-box. The listing further confirms the phone will offer better storage, gaming experience, and photography.
GSMArena in its report points out that the “big storage” could refer to 64GB built-in storage. The phone could also support microSD card for expandable storage. Redmi 9i could also come with a 6.53-inch HD display, 5,000mAh battery, and MediaTek Helio G25 processor.
Redmi 9i will follow Redmi 9A which launched in India last month. Available with price starting at ₹6,799, the phone comes with a 6.53-inch HD+ LCD display with 20:9 aspect ratio. It runs on MediaTek Helio G25 octa-core processor clocked at 2.0Hz.
Redmi 9A comes in two options - 2GB/32GB and 3GB/32GB. The smartphone is powered by a 5,000mAh battery. On the camera front, the Redmi 9A features a 13-megapixel AI rear camera. On the front, it comes with a 5-megapixel AI selfie camera.
So far, Xiaomi offers Redmi 9A, Redmi 9 Prime, and Redmi 9 smartphones in the lineup. The Redmi 9 Prime is available in India for a starting price of ₹9,999. The base Redmi 9 is available for a starting price of ₹8,999.
